§ 60-1007 — Same; sale of property to satisfy judgment

(a)Any sale conducted under the provisions of this section shall be subject to the provisions of K.S.A. 60-2406, and amendments thereto, except that the disposition of proceeds after the satisfaction of senior security interests or liens shall be made in accordance with the provisions of K.S.A. 60-1009, and amendments thereto. Before the sheriff proceeds to sell the personal property pursuant to order of the court, the sheriff shall cause public notice to be given of the time and place of sale, for at least 14 days before the day of sale.
